Undergraduate admission to Tarleton Fort Worth, Waco, Texas A&M-RELLIS, and Online requires: 

These Transfer locations only offer upper-division courses. If your degree requires additional lower-level courses, some may be available online, but you may also need to complete courses at another institution and transfer them to Tarleton. Financial Aid Consortiums with Tarleton’s community college partners are available to assist with the cost of dual enrollment.

What credits will transfer?

  • If you are core complete at another Texas public college or university, you will be considered core complete at Tarleton
  • Maximum of 90 credit hours can be applied to a 120-credit hour bachelor’s degree
  • Training may count as college credit for select degree programs; ask us to learn more

Professional completion degrees at Tarleton recognize your existing knowledge through professional training, certifications, and technical coursework. Whether your career started with military specialization, a technical program, career training, or professional certification, Tarleton recognizes that higher education happens outside the classroom.  These types of training can account for credit hours within these degree programs. The hours and types of training will be evaluated to determine the number of college credits earned.  Our programs will equip students with the necessary skills for academic advancement and success in today’s competitive workplace.

Note:

  • These programs are designed for students who have completed an Associate of Applied Science program in a technical area or have program-specific training already completed and want to complete their bachelor’s degrees using online courses. 
  • Contact an academic advisor to find out how to get credit for prior learning and maximize credit transfer.
